Fazakerley Train Station is equipped to ensure your journey is smooth and hassle-free. When it comes to purchasing tickets, a ticket office is available during the weekdays as well as on Sundays, but keep in mind there are no ticket machines. Don’t forget, your smartcards can be both issued and validated here for added convenience.
For travelers requiring accessibility accommodations, Fazakerley is commendably equipped. With step-free access available throughout, it’s classified as a Category A station meaning every platform is accessible. Additionally, there is a ramp for train access and an induction loop system for those with auditory needs, ensuring everyone can travel with ease and confidence.
Unfortunately, there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, but you’ll find essential amenities like seating areas and secure bicycle storage, complete with CCTV surveillance for peace of mind. Cyclists can enjoy the use of free secure cycle storage. Plan ahead as there aren’t any accessible taxis or car park facilities at this station.
Fazakerley is well-positioned for your onward journey. Although there's no taxi rank directly at the station, the nearby Longmoor Lane offers rail replacement services when necessary. For those planning a flight,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is the nearest aerial gateway. Convenient travel options allow you to purchase rail/bus tickets that encompass your journey to the airport, using services like the 86A or 80A bus directly from Liverpool South Parkway.
Bus travel is very much accessible from Fazakerley. For detailed on-route information, Merseytravel is your go-to source and is readily accessible online or via their contact number. Though lacking a direct taxi service, the interconnectedness of Fazakerley makes for easy navigation.

First and foremost, Winnersh Triangle station provides a variety of ticket purchasing options designed to cater to various passenger needs. The ticket office operates from Monday to Friday, 6:00 AM to 11:00 AM, and on Saturdays from 8:00 AM to 1:00 PM.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, catering to regular purchases and those requiring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
For assistance, customer help points are strategically placed, but note that the staff help is limited at this location. There's excellent provision for passengers needing hearing assistance, with induction loops available, while the lack of step-free access might require advance planning for those with mobility challenges. The station does feature CCTV to ensure safety and security during your visit.
The transport options extend beyond train travel, making it easy to reach your destination. Rail replacement services are conveniently available at Reading Road Cavendish Gardens Bus Stops. For those needing further travel guidance, detailed bus information is readily accessible here.
